Gideon’s unique half-pound cookies gained rapid national fame as sources from The New York Times to Sports Illustrated dubbed them “the best cookies in the world.” Combined with a new Disney Springs location on the way, Gideon’s needed a new website that could portray its unique brand and handle the fulfillment demands of its exponential growth.

Through intentional design and user experience, we delivered a website that is not only a fun representation of the bakeshop’s eccentric and unique brand but also serves to streamline a complex ordering and fulfillment process. Gideon’s Bakehouse has the unique challenge of combining products for preorders, in-store pickups, and shipping—all into one cart and checkout experience.

The proof is in the...cookie.

With an increase in sales of more than 500% within two weeks of launch, Gideon’s new and improved ecommerce site proved to be exactly what they needed at a time of unexpected exponential growth. Today, Gideon’s high-traffic, profit-driving website still complements its physical locations’ merchandise and preorder bake sales.
